When it comes to fitness nutrition, honey isn’t just a natural sweetener — it’s a powerhouse of energy and health benefits. Whether you’re an endurance athlete, a gym enthusiast, or someone just looking to stay fit, the right type of honey can support your workouts, recovery, and overall wellness.

Why Honey Is a Fitness Favorite

Honey is more than just sugar. It contains a mix of simple sugars (glucose and fructose) that are rapidly absorbed by the body, providing quick energy before or during workouts. It also includes antioxidants, vitamins, minerals, and enzymes that support immunity and reduce exercise-induced inflammation. Unlike refined sugar, honey has a lower glycemic index — meaning it can give you energy without a sharp blood sugar spike and crash.


Top Honeys for Fitness Enthusiasts

🐝 1. Manuka Honey

Manuka honey, primarily from New Zealand, is rich in methylglyoxal (MGO) — a compound known for its strong antioxidant and antibacterial properties. These qualities help speed up recovery and support immune function, which is crucial if you train hard and often.

Best for: Recovery, immunity, and daily wellness


🍯 2. Acacia Honey

Light in flavor and high in fructose, acacia honey is absorbed slowly, helping maintain steady energy levels. It’s ideal pre-workout fuel that won’t cause a sugar crash.

Best for: Pre-workout energy and healthy metabolism


🌼 3. Buckwheat Honey

Darker and richer in antioxidants than many other varieties, buckwheat honey helps neutralize free radicals produced during intense exercise. Its robust taste also makes it a favorite in protein smoothies and energy bars.

Best for: Antioxidant support and recovery


🏃 4. Wildflower Honey

Wildflower honey is versatile and nutrient-dense, with varying flavonoids depending on the flowers the bees visited. Its balanced sugar profile makes it a good all-around option for energy, recovery, and daily use.

Best for: Overall health and sustained energy


How to Use Honey in Your Fitness Routine

Pre-Workout: A spoonful 20–30 minutes before training for quick energy
During Long Sessions: Mix honey into water or electrolyte drinks
Post-Workout: Add it to smoothies or greek yogurt for muscle recovery
